Bureau Veritas holds talks with Dubai Customs World to boost DCW Services worldwide

A high level French delegation from the global quality assurance group Bureau Veritas visited DC World today (September 24) to discuss mutual interests and business potential.
Mr. Ahmad Al Marri, Director, DC World, welcomed the delegation and spotlighted the various mutual points that DC World can share with Bureau Veritas.
Mr. Ahmad Al Marri said: "Bureau Veritas is a global provider of quality assurance services and corporate compliance solutions including Customs management, and we are ready to share our collective and cumulative expertise in innovative customs management to jointly enhance ICT position in the business world."
"We consider this visit as a strategic move that will help increase the efficiency of trade operations and will draw the global evolution of customs around the world," he added.
Elie Sawaya, Government Services and International Trade, Bureau Veritas, said: "DC World is the leader global customs solutions provider. This visit is to identify DC World services that we can offer for our clients to facilitate their trade processes."
"Our clients are mainly governmental organizations and we are keen to enhance the quality of services we provide for them especially in the IT -based arena. DC World offers us a secure information exchange via online portals and a robust and reliable software solutions package," he added.
DC World presented a documentary showing its development and global presence emphasizing on services offered including management and assistance in customs operations, customs consultancy and management of customs free zones.
The presentation showcased the e-services provided by DC World and Farida H. Mohammed, Sr. Manager support management, DC World spoke of the successful model of customs management they set up in Djibouti.
A presentation on Mirsal World was given to the delegation showing the efficiency and secured online applications.
They briefed the delegation on the features of Mirsal World including the valuation reference and IPR protection control in addition to post clearance audit control.
They discussed customs duties valuation according to the unified code system with rates based on the tariffs in country of origin, protection from revenue leakage and other facilities such as updating of corporate data through e-compliance audit, risk management and free zone and bonded warehouse management features.
Commenting on Mirsal World, Sawaya said: "This is a state of the art solution present in the market and it provides a comprehensive set of innovative tools in customs management."
Farida Mohammed said: "DC World stands on the front rows of modern computerized solutions providers; we have offered our products to a vast spectrum of global markets. This partnership with Bureau Veritas is an additional international akcnowledgement of the value-added services that meet with the global expectations and universal standards."
Later, Farida Mohammed accompanied the delegation in their tour in DC World departments to further explain the inspection procedures, DC World operational processes and e-clearance service.
